Responsibilities may include the following and other duties may be assigned:
Provide technical and clinical support during procedures to ensure the safe and effective use of Medtronic products and therapies
Deliver product training and clinical education to physicians nurses technicians and other healthcare professionals
Develop and maintain strong professional relationships with healthcare providers and hospital staff
Collaborate with sales marketing and clinical teams to support account development and therapy adoption
Monitor and manage consignment inventory within assigned hospitals to ensure product availability for procedures
Maintain accurate records of case support activities customer interactions and inventory using company systems
Ensure compliance with company policies quality standards and regulatory requirements
Provide clinical support during Percutaneous Coronary Intervention (PCI) procedures using Medtronic coronary technologies
Support physicians during Renal Denervation (RDN) procedures and assist with therapy adoption initiatives
Work closely with Catheterization Laboratory (Cath Lab) teams to support procedures and deliver clinical training

Required Knowledge and Experience:
Bachelors degree in Biomedical Engineering Medical Technology Nursing Clinical Sciences or a related healthcare field
23 years of experience in medical devices clinical support healthcare services or a related industry
Strong communication and presentation skills with the ability to build effective relationships with healthcare professionals
Ability to learn and apply technical and clinical knowledge in a fast-paced clinical environment
Willingness to travel frequently within the assigned territory
Fluency in English and Arabic.
Preferred qualifications include experience working in catheterization laboratories (Cath Lab) interventional cardiology vascular or other cardiovascular procedures as well as familiarity with medical device technologies and clinical case support. Additional certifications or training related to biomedical engineering or clinical applications are considered an advantage.
